Italian football giants AC Milan have launched pitchside seating for VIP ticket holders and fans. The move is inspired by the NBA courtside seating, which is a big premium ticket in the world of Sports and Entertainment. The LA Lakers brought out Hollywood superstars in the 1980s, adding to the appeal of their style of basketball at the time, known as ‘Showtime’. The Barclays Arena and Madison Square Garden in New York, home of the Brooklyn Nets and New York Knicks respectively, often have musicians, actors, and other types of ‘A’ list personalities courtside throughout the season. Increasingly, we are seeing global football stars positioned on courtside to see the current stars of the NBA up close.

AC Milan showcased the seating with Italian rap artists Ghali and Blanco among the guests for the opening last Thursday evening for the Europa League fixture against Roma. The pitchside seats are situated between the Home and Away dugouts at the San Siro, and guests are able to have the closest view entering and leaving the pitch. Along with padded seats, there is also a concierge available at your service for what’s being labelled as the best seats in the house.

Personally, the up-close view is not the one I would prefer to pay a premium for, but for celebrities, it represents a great opportunity to be visible and more connected with the players and the game. I can see this being a big hit, but whether it will catch on may depend on if other teams can make the necessary modifications and adjustments to make the pitchside experience worthwhile. Whoever occupies that central pitch area as a spectator at AC Milan probably does not want to move for the refurbishments, but if there is demand, then they may have to accept change.

When Football GOAT Lionel Messi moved to Inter Miami, we saw the pitchside experience being absorbed by Kim Kardashian, Lebron James and Serena Williams, as well as a host of celebrities in Miami.

I can see PSG, Real Madrid, Barcelona, and Bayern Munich taking notes as fellow European giants. The stadiums are good enough, although the Camp Nou needs a rebuild, and timing could be an issue. The newer stadiums in the Premier League should be able to adapt as well, but moving forward, I can see any new stadium designs catering for this VIP pitchside seating. Indeed, the Etihad has a similar experience called the tunnel club as a premium hospitality package, and other Premier League clubs will look at AC Milan’s new innovation to leverage their hospitality experiences.
